Who We’re Looking For
Toyota’s Sustainable Development Division (SDD) is looking for a passionate and highly motivated Executive Administrative Assistant to join our team.
The primary responsibility of this role is to provide comprehensive administrative support to the Vice President by handling a range of executive support tasks and facilitating effective communication within the organization while contributing to the development and implementation of strategic initiatives.
Reporting to the Vice President, Sustainable Development, the person in this role will support SDD’s mission to expand access to opportunities and create a culture that embraces diversity and inclusion to strengthen communities and our business.
This position is based in Plano, Texas. The selected candidate will be expected to reside within commutable distance of this location.
What You’ll Be Doing
- Manage the VP's calendar and travel arrangements, ensuring optimal time management and prioritization of tasks to align with strategic objectives.
- Prepare and edit correspondence, presentations, and reports for the VP, maintaining a high level of accuracy and attention to detail, and ensuring alignment with strategic goals.
- Coordinate and schedule department meetings, including preparing agendas and following up on action items, with a focus on strategic priorities.
- Oversee the daily operations of the VP's office, ensuring a well-organized and efficient work environment that supports strategic initiatives, including maintenance of office supplies and equipment.
- Facilitate effective communication within the SDD executive team and across the organization, with a focus on strategic alignment.
- Process expense reports in a timely manner, with strong knowledge of Travel & Expense policies to ensure compliance.
- Apply judgment with full understanding of urgency, confidentiality, and priorities of the business, routinely needing to multi-task with little to no direction.
- Represent the Sustainable Development Division with poised and highly professional written and verbal communication, both internally and externally.
- Be the voice for continuous improvement in approach and processes.
